1. e4 c5 2. Nc3 Nc6 3. g3 d6 4. Bg2 g6 5. d3 Bg7 6. Be3 e5 7. f4 Nge7 8. Nf3 Nd4 9. O-O O-O 10. Qd2 exf4 11. Bxf4 Bg4 12. Rae1 Qd7 13. Nd5 Nxd5 14. exd5 Nxf3+ 15. Bxf3 Bh3 16. Bg2 Bxg2 17. Kxg2 Rfe8 18. h3 b5 19. Rxe8+ Rxe8 20. Re1 h6 21. Rxe8+ Qxe8 22. c4 bxc4 23. dxc4 Qe4+ 24. Kh2 Qe7 25. b3 g5 26. Be3 Qe4 27. Bf2 Be5 28. a3 Qf3 29. b4 cxb4 30. axb4 f5 31. c5 dxc5 32. bxc5 f4 33. g4 Qe3 34. Qe1 Qxe1 35. Bxe1 Kf7 36. Kg2 Ke7 37. Kf3 Kd7 38. Ke4 Bb8 39. Bc3 Bc7 40. Bg7 a5 41. Bb2 a4 42. c6+ Ke7 43. Ba3+ Kd8 44. d6 Bb6 45. Bb2 Kc8 46. d7+ Kc7 47. Kd5 1–0

This chess game between Federico Galassi (2229) and Guido Frilli (2131) was played at Cesenatico Open 9th in 2004 and finished 1–0. The opening was the Sicilian Defense: Closed (B26).
